Ingredients You’ll Need for The Best Salad Ever
- Salad Base:
- 6 cups mixed greens (such as spinach, arugula, and lettuce)
- 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
- 1 cucumber, sliced
- 1 bell pepper, diced
- 1/2 red onion, thinly sliced
- Toppings:
- 1/2 cup feta cheese, crumbled
- 1/4 cup olives, pitted and sliced
- Dressing:
- 1/4 cup balsamic vinaigrette
- Seasoning:
- Salt and pepper to taste
Note: Feel free to substitute feta cheese with a dairy-free option or leave it out altogether for a lighter salad. You can also play with different vinaigrettes to enhance the flavor.
How to Make The Best Salad Ever
-
Combine Fresh Ingredients: In a large bowl, combine the mixed greens, cherry tomatoes, cucumber, bell pepper, red onion, feta cheese, and olives. Gently toss to mix evenly.
-
Dress the Salad: Drizzle the balsamic vinaigrette over the salad. Toss gently to coat all ingredients without bruising the greens.
-
Season to Taste: Add salt and pepper according to your preference. Toss again to incorporate.
-
Serve and Enjoy: Serve the salad immediately for the freshest taste.

Storage and Reheating
- Refrigerator Storage: Store any leftovers in an airtight container for up to 3 days. Keep the dressing separate until ready to eat.
- Freezer Storage: It’s not recommended to freeze this salad due to the texture of fresh vegetables.
- Reheating Note: This salad is best served cold, and reheating is not suggested.
- Meal Prep Tip: Prepare the veggies in advance and store them in separate containers for easy assembling during the week.
Common Mistakes to Avoid
- Overdressing: Adding too much dressing can make the salad soggy. Start with less and add more as needed.
- Using Wilting Ingredients: Ensure all vegetables are fresh and crisp for the best flavor and texture.
- Cutting Vegetables Too Small: Large chunks of vegetables add a satisfying crunch, so avoid chopping them too small.
- Not Tossing Well: Gently mix the ingredients to ensure even distribution without damaging delicate greens.
- Skipping Seasoning: Always taste and season before serving to enhance the flavor.

Frequently Asked Questions
Can I make this salad ahead of time?
Yes, you can prepare the vegetables a day in advance; just keep them refrigerated. Avoid adding dressing until ready to serve to maintain freshness.
What kind of olives work best for this salad?
Both Kalamata and black olives are great options; choose your favorite for flavor preference.
Can I use a different dressing?
Absolutely! Any vinaigrette or even a lemon olive oil dressing can complement the ingredients beautifully.
What is the best way to store leftovers?
Keep the salad in an airtight container and store it in the refrigerator; consume within three days for best quality.
How do I make this salad vegan?
You can leave out the feta cheese and replace the balsamic vinaigrette with a vegan dressing for a completely plant-based option.
